I am working on a old RF Generator and I now need a part but I can not dind any specs for it. T he part has the following on it: 0142 and below that it says M952
Any idea of what it could be replaced with ? Appreciate any help.
It certainly looks like a Motorola device and the 952 is probably a date code, I would guess 1989 week 52 but I can't trace any reference to 0142 around that date or later so it could be house coded instead of having a generic number.
What is the model of the RF Generator? It may be easier to trace the manual for it and work backwards to trace the part or a replacement.
